Design details of torque limiter SK5

Six self-centering, tapered drive projections
(2) have been formed into the taper segment,
which has been molded onto an aluminium
hub (1).

The six projections are configured conically in
a longitudinal direction (3). The mating-piece
consists of a metal bellows with a tapered
female element (4).

Absolutely backlash-free torque transmission
is ensured due to the axial pretensioning (5) of
the metal bellows during mounting. This slight
pretensioning has no negative influence on the
operation of the metal bellows or on the shaft
bearing.

Possible applications for backlash-free, press-fit torque limiter SK5

(1) Applications with limited accessibility.
The dismounting of a singlepiece
coupling is too labor intensive.

(2) The press fit design allows the
motor or gear box unit to be removed
by simply pulling it out when
servicing is required.

Dismounting the coupling is possible
without loosening the hub fastening
screws. Therefore, clamping
screw access holes are not required.
